Sensitivity Adjustment
Special hints
Recommended adjustment
To assure stable working conditions the green stability LED should
be always turned on.
The green LED displays two stability conditions:
1. Output stable ON (red LED on)
2. Output stable OFF (red LED off)
Best performance can be achieved if the sensing object is located
closer than -10 % of the setting distance or the shiny background is
fixed +10 % behind the switching position.
Item
Position A
Position B and C
Setting
Adjustment
procedure
Place the detected object at the de-
sired location and turn the LIGHT indi-
cator (red) lights. This is position A
Background object
Remove the detected object and turn
the adjustment knob clockwise until the
LIGHT indicator(red) lights. This is the
position B.
Then turn the adjustment knob coun-
terclockwise until the LIGHT indicator
(red) goes out. This is position C.
No Background object
The maximum adjustment setting is
used as position C.
Set the adjustment to halfway between
A and C. Confirm that the STAB indica-
tor (green) remains lit both with the de-
tected object present and not present.
If the STAB indicator does not remain
lit, review the detection method to en-
able stable operation.
